The Birth of Endurance: Manufacturing Marvels of HDPE Plastic Sheets
The creation of "hdpe plastic sheets" is a carefully orchestrated process, marrying advanced engineering with a deep understanding of polymer science. Starting from ethylene, a simple organic compound, the process of polymerization transforms it into long, chain-like molecules. These chains, characterized by their tightly packed structure, are the source of HDPE’s impressive density and strength. Manufacturers utilize diverse techniques, each carefully selected based on the desired characteristics of the final sheet. Extrusion, a process where molten plastic is forced through a die, is a common method for producing continuous sheets. Compression molding, on the other hand, provides precision shaping, while calendaring yields sheets of consistent thickness. The quality control and technological sophistication employed in this production are crucial in determining the final performance characteristics of the product.
The Power of Performance: Key Attributes of Plastic HDPE Sheetss
The appeal of High density plastic sheets stems from an exceptional set of attributes that cater to demanding applications. The material's outstanding chemical resistance is a notable advantage. It can withstand prolonged exposure to a broad range of corrosive substances, solvents, and bases without degradation. HDPE sheets are also celebrated for their exceptional impact strength, allowing them to withstand significant physical forces and demanding environments. The low moisture absorption property prevents swelling, warping, and the growth of microorganisms in damp conditions. In addition, HDPE exhibits exceptional durability and flexibility, making them the ideal candidate for various structural applications.
A World of Applications: Exploring the Versatility of HDPE Sheets
The adaptability of HDPE sheets is perhaps best demonstrated by the sheer diversity of their applications. Their chemical inertness and durability make them a reliable choice in the construction industry, particularly for applications requiring resistance to water and chemical exposure. HDPE sheets can be used in creating robust linings for landfills and containment structures. The food and beverage industry also benefits significantly from HDPE's properties, utilizing it for cutting boards, storage containers, and packaging materials. Furthermore, HDPE sheets are commonly utilized in manufacturing playgrounds, water tanks, and various chemical storage equipment because of their durability. They are also an important component in many automotive products, including fuel tanks.
Championing Sustainability: The Environmental Footprint of HDPE Sheets
While HDPE offers numerous benefits, its environmental impact is a crucial consideration. As a thermoplastic, HDPE is recyclable, meaning that it can be melted down and reprocessed, turning old products into new ones and reducing the need for virgin materials. To maximize this advantage, strong recycling infrastructures, alongside proactive consumer participation, are vital. Furthermore, innovations in bio-based HDPE materials, derived from renewable resources rather than fossil fuels, represent a promising path towards a more sustainable future.

Beyond the Ordinary: Advanced Applications of HDPE Sheets
HDPE sheet technology has progressed far beyond its basic applications, introducing advanced developments and innovative uses. Through co-extrusion processes, sheets can be created with multiple layers, each possessing unique properties. Additives are introduced to enhance properties such as UV resistance, flame retardancy, and to change friction.

Frequently Asked Questions (FAQs)
1. What are the main differences between HDPE and PVC sheets?
HDPE is more flexible, impact-resistant, and better at resisting chemicals compared to PVC. However, PVC often exhibits better resistance to fire. The ideal material depends on the application.
2. Can HDPE sheets withstand high temperatures?
HDPE can withstand relatively high temperatures, but its heat resistance is lower compared to some other plastics. Prolonged exposure to extreme heat can cause deformation or damage.
3. Are HDPE sheets food-safe?
Yes, HDPE is generally considered food-safe, and the material can be utilized in contact with food products. Ensure to comply with industry-specific regulations for any contact with consumable products.
4. What is the best way to clean HDPE sheets?
HDPE sheets are easy to clean. Usually, a mild soap and water solution will do. However, if harsh chemicals are used on the sheets, make sure it is safe for HDPE material and follow the manufacturer's specifications.
